Hunting stories often glorify hunters, as they are the ones who write the tales. However, in this book, Dénètem Touam Bona takes a different perspective by adopting the concept of marronage to shed light on the lives and creativity of colonized and subjugated peoples. Through a blend of travel diary, anthropological inquiry, and philosophical and literary reflection, he narrates the hidden history of fugues, encompassing those of runaway slaves, deserting soldiers, clandestine migrants, and all those who challenged norms and forms of control. Within the realm of the fugue, amidst the folds and retreats of dense and muggy woods, runaway countercultures emerged and flourished, offering alternative organizations and values that stood in stark contrast to the colonial societies.

Marronage, the art of disappearance, has become increasingly relevant in our contemporary world: it serves as a means to evade surveillance, profiling, and tracking by both the police and corporations. It enables individuals to disappear from databases and extend the shadows of forests with the mere click of a key. In our increasingly cyberconnected society, where real-time control over individuals is becoming the norm, we must reimagine marronage and recognize the maroon as a universal figure of resistance.

Beyond its critical dimension, this book proposes a cosmopoetics of refuge, aiming to revitalize the power of dreams and poetry to counteract the confinement of minds and bodies. It encourages us to embrace the transformative potential of escape and to seek solace in the depths of nature, where the boundaries between human and non-human worlds blur. By exploring the lives and experiences of maroons, this book offers a profound reflection on the complexities of resistance, resilience, and the pursuit of freedom in a world that often seeks to confine and control.
